乘法表SQL Server 实现九九乘法表简易指南(sqlserver 九九)
SQL Server的九九乘法表实现简易指南
九九乘法表是一个老生常谈的问题,学校里有它,聚众时,老人们谈它,SQL Server也不例外,也有着不少方式为用户实现九九乘法表。在SQL Server上创建九九乘法表,有很多工具可以使用,比如存储过程和函数等,今天我们就来讨论一下SQL Server如何创建九九乘法表,本文提供简易指南,帮助用户更好的使用SQL Server。
本文以单表模式为例介绍SQL Server 如何创建九九乘法表。在这种模式中,有一个表叫做“乘法表”,该表主要用于保存乘法表的数据,所以要创建九九乘法表,我们需要创建一张表“乘法表”,该表包含若干个字段,如下所示:
* Number1:int,用于保存乘法表第一个乘数;
* Number2:int,用于保存乘法表第二个乘数;
* Product:int,用于保存乘法表结果;
让我们开始使用以下代码创建乘法表:
Create Table MultiplicationTable
(
Number1 int,
Number2 int,
Product int
)
我们已经完成了对“乘法表”的构建,就可以填入数据了,我们可以使用for循环的语法,然后把循环中的乘数和结果插入到表中,比如实现九九乘法表,可以使用如下代码:
for(int i=1;i
{
for(int j=1;j
{
insert into MultiplicationTable (Number1,Number2,Product)
values (i,j,i*j);
}
}
当然实现九九乘法表这件事情我们还可以使用存储过程+触发器或者函数,因此是一个有趣多变的问题,我们可以根据具体需求来灵活实现。
本文就简要介绍了如何使用SQL Server创建九九乘法表,从而让IT从业者更加容易的实现此项功能。希望本文对你有所帮助,谢谢。